Enrollment Process

FPDS currently has five classrooms: Infants-Ones, Twos-Threes, Fours-Fives and a virtual classroom space for 5-8 year-olds. We serve children between the ages of 6 weeks and 8-years-old. 

Enrollment occurs based on availability:

  1. Families currently enrolled are given priority to renew their commitment for the following year, including any additional siblings. 

  2. Families on the waiting list are then offered space (with attention to date of entry on the waiting list and priority—Children of staff, Duke affiliation, and board of directors).

  3. If there are any remaining spaces available after exhausting the waiting list, spaces will then be offered "first come, first served."  

Upon acceptance of a space, families will provide a refundable deposit equal to one-half month of tuition. Deposit is only refundable if given a 30-day written notice.
